Laura Elizabeth Hill McLaughlin (born September 3, 1893,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ania - died February 22, 1991) was a computer, instructor and researcher of astronomy. As an astronomer of the Detroit Observatory for the University of Michigan, she conducted research work alongside her husband, fellow Detroit Observatory astronomer Dean B. Mclaughlin.[1]
